  • The Northeast Regional is Amtrak’s passenger rail service that runs between Boston, MA and Virginia Beach, VA, connecting over 50 cities in the Northeast and Mid-Atlantic regions of the United States. While the line’s downtown-to-downtown train service makes traveling between the biggest cities in the Northeast convenient and hassle-free, the train’s amenities make the journey comfortable and relaxing as well. Amtrak passengers can enjoy large seats with extra legroom and power outlets, as well as free WiFi and clean bathrooms. City Information

New Carrollton

New Carrollton is a small town in the Washington, D.C. metropolitan area, located about 13 miles northeast of the nation's capital. Much of the city is residential, with services typical for a suburb, including a shopping mall, grocery stores, several restaurants, and so on. A true hidden gem in the area is Greenbelt Park, a forested park with 172 campsites and nine miles of trails perfect for an escape to nature.

A few hotels in New Carrollton and neighboring Lanham welcome D.C. visitors who would rather not pay downtown prices. It's easy to reach D.C. from the New Carrollton station, which connects to the Washington Metro's Orange Line and the MARC trains that serve Maryland. It takes just 11 minutes to reach Union Station in D.C. from New Carrollton on the Metro.

The New Carrollton train station is also a stop for Amtrak trains heading north. The Northeast Regional departing from D.C. makes its first stop in New Carrollton before continuing on to Philadelphia, New York City, and Boston. In addition, bus lines provide service to New Carrollton from as far away as Indianapolis or St. Louis. For those who prefer to fly, the nearest major airport is the Ronald Reagan Washington National Airport.

Quantico

Quantico, made famous by several TV shows, is a real town in Prince William, Virginia. Quantico is about 36 miles outside of Washington, DC. Marine Corps Base Quantico is the largest Marine Corps base in the United States. Other agencies, such as the FBI Academy and the Naval Criminal Investigative Service, are also located on the base, though sadly, NCIS isn't actually filmed there.
